Q2 What maintenance is required for the Kia Telluride exhaust system?
What maintenance is required for the Kia Telluride exhaust system?
The Kia Telluride exhaust system requires minimal maintenance. Regularly inspect the system for rust, cracks, or loose components. Ensure the exhaust hangers and brackets are secure. Cleaning the exterior with a mild detergent can prevent corrosion. Follow the vehicle's maintenance schedule for catalytic converter and muffler inspections, typically every 30,000 miles or as recommended by the manufacturer.
Q3 How do I install or replace the exhaust system on a Kia Telluride?
How do I install or replace the exhaust system on a Kia Telluride?
To install or replace the exhaust system, first, lift the vehicle securely using a jack and stands. Remove the old exhaust by detaching the hangers, clamps, and bolts. Align the new exhaust system, ensuring proper fitment, and secure it using the provided hardware. Tighten all connections and double-check for leaks. It is advisable to consult the service manual or seek professional assistance for precise installation.
Q4 What should I do if my Kia Telluride exhaust system is making unusual noises?
What should I do if my Kia Telluride exhaust system is making unusual noises?
Unusual noises from the exhaust system may indicate loose components, leaks, or damage. Inspect the system for loose hangers, cracked pipes, or holes. Tighten any loose connections and replace damaged parts. If the issue persists, check the catalytic converter and muffler for internal damage. A professional diagnostic may be necessary to identify and resolve the problem.
